Audiophile 2496 MIDI Setup
The Audiophile’s MIDI input and output ports may be connected to external MIDI
devices. The diagram below shows connection to a MIDI controller keyboard, which
is also being used as a sound module. The MIDI output of the Audiophile 2496 may
be used with just a sound module, while the MIDI input may alternately be used to
receive MIDI timecode for synchronization purposes.
1. Connect the MIDI out port of your controller keyboard to the MIDI In of the
Audiophile breakout cable using a standard MIDI cable.
2. Connect the MIDI Out port of the Audiophile breakout cable to the MIDI in of
your controller keyboard, also using a standard MIDI cable.
3. Connect the audio outputs of the keyboard to either a mixer, sound system, or the
audio inputs of the Audiophile 2496 card.
